Our Presence in Ireland
Abbott employs around 6,000 people across ten sites in Ireland. We have six manufacturing facilities in Clonmel, Cootehill, Donegal, Longford, Sligo, and a third-party manufacturing management operation in Sligo.
In addition to these locations, we also have commercial, support operations, and shared services in Dublin and Galway. We have been making a difference in the lives of Irish people since 1946.
The Future of Diabetes Care
We are opening a new manufacturing facility in Kilkenny, which will serve as a centre for world-class engineering, quality, medical device manufacturing, and other science-based professionals.
This facility will produce life-changing technologies, including the FreeStyle Libre 3 system, which automatically delivers real-time glucose readings directly to smartphones.
